The Proton Exora 2018 sits between compact MPVs and larger ones, making it relevant when you want more cabin space without moving into heavier vehicles.

It offers a slightly roomier feel than Alza, especially for passengers, but does not reach the comfort level of Innova. It fills the gap when you need more space but still want to stay within a moderate budget.

1. What makes Exora feel different from Alza?
It provides slightly more interior space for passengers.

2. When does that extra space become useful?
When travelling with taller passengers or longer seating duration.

3. What trade-off comes with choosing Exora?
Less refinement compared to Toyota MPVs.

4. In which situation would it feel less suitable?
When higher comfort or smoother ride is expected.

5. What type of group benefits most from Exora?
Groups needing space but not prioritising premium comfort.
